Fast Make Ready Rapida For Fast Turn
Round Printer
Nottinghamshire general commercial printer, RCS, has ordered a KBA Rapida five-colour press fast make-ready machine.
Nottinghamshire general commercial printer, RCS, has ordered a KBA Rapida five-colour press fast make-ready machine The Rapida, which was due to be installed at the Retford UK company during December 2003 is RCS's first KBA and the machine joins a pressroom currently operating two MAN Roland 700s and two Heidelberg 52s

RCS managing director, Michael Todd said: "It was the fast make-ready of the Rapida that attracted me.
My philosophy is that as soon as a job is on press I want it off! The machine has a number of features only grudgingly offered by other suppliers and we look forward to the machineïs arrival." The Rapida, part of a £1m strategic investment by RCS, follows consistent new technology purchases including Lotem Quantum CTP and CIP data control of press and post press operations.
The KBA Rapida will now allow RCS to further step up production.
It is envisaged that the new press will be run 24 hours-a-day, six days-a-week.
RCS was originally founded as Rainbow Copy Shop in 1990.
Beginning with a Gestetner 311, the business has seen consistent expansion before moving to its present modern 35,000 sq ft factory in 2001.
